  • Analyzing Customers in Your Business Plan  By : Nisha Garg
    The Customer Analysis section of the business plan assesses the customer segments that the company serves. In it, the company must 1) identify its target customers, 2) convey the needs of these customers, and 3) show how its products and services satisfy these needs.
  • Analyzing your Bank Statement On a Daily Basis  By : Mr G
    How many business owners take out the time to review and analyze their bank statements, daily? When we perform accounting tasks we basically record data from the bank statement and perform reconciliation to our cashbook or ledgers.
    Evaluating transactions on a bank statement is a completely different exercise from accounting for the respective items. Businesses lose thousands, due to failure to review the transactions on their bank statements, regularly.

  • Are Interruptions Eating Away Your Time?  By : Barb Friedman
    The average interruption costs anywhere between 10-20 minutes of someone's precious time. If you have 4 interruptions a day, that amounts to one hour of productive time. Time that you can't get back.

    You really can control your time. It is important to let others know that while you will make time to discuss their needs, you still value your own time.
